Jefferson Park's Annual Fall Fest Returns This Weekend with Arts, Crafts, and Pumpkin Fun

By Socialhood News · Il/Chicago/Jefferson Park ·

Jefferson Park residents are gearing up for one of the neighborhood's most anticipated autumn events this Saturday, October 12. The annual Fall Fest at Jefferson Memorial Park (4822 N. Long Ave.) will run from 11:00 a.m. to 2:00 p.m., offering a variety of family-friendly activities. Community members can look forward to arts and crafts for children, a Halloween costume swap, and, of course, plenty of pumpkins.

The event comes as the Lawrence Avenue shopping district experiences a notable revival. Once plagued by vacant storefronts, the corridor between Austin and Major avenues has welcomed five new businesses in recent months, including El Milagrito Meat And Produce Market, A Taste of the Philippines, Vito's Vault dinner theater, Sunny Village Kids Cafe, and Plot Twist Used Books. Local business owner Chris Meyer envisions branding the area as "Jeff West" and creating the Northwest Side's version of Lincoln Square, noting that "this block is starting to get livelier" with these new additions.

Meanwhile, residents have expressed mixed reactions to the Chicago Department of Transportation's recent installation of traffic-calming bump-outs along Avondale Avenue. While designed to address speeding concerns, some locals worry about potential hazards, particularly during winter with snow plows.
